KUWAIT. 1991. The invasion of Kuwait by Iraq took place on August 2nd 1990. It was followed by the Allied intervention under operation Desert Storm. The Allies finally liberated Kuwait on February 27th 1991, after 7 months of occupation and 5 weeks of war. After its liberation, Kuwait has managed to return to its Old Ways. Burgan oil fields. Oil wells on fire in the background and a destroyed Iraqi tank.
